Château d'eau de Bourges

The Château d'eau de Bourges, a striking architectural gem, stands proudly on the edge of Place Séraucourt in Bourges, France. Constructed between 1865 and 1867, this neoclassical water tower is a testament to the ingenuity of its creators, engineer Paul-Adrien Bourdalouë and architect Albert Tissandier. With its elegant design and historical significance, the Château d'eau has become a cherished landmark in the heart of Bourges.

The History of the Château d'eau de Bourges

The Château d'eau was inaugurated on August 18, 1867, by then-mayor Pierre Planchat. It was originally designed to serve as a vital part of the city's water supply system, drawing water from a pumping station in the Auron Valley. Its construction was a significant engineering feat of the time, reflecting the technological advancements of the 19th century.

The tower's neoclassical facade, adorned with intricate sculptures by Jules Dumoutet, adds a touch of grandeur to its functional purpose. The design includes a large niche framed by pilasters and topped with a decorative pediment, showcasing the artistic flair of the era. Once featuring a grand staircase and fountain, the tower has undergone changes over the years, yet it retains its majestic presence.

Exploring the Château d'eau Today

Today, the Château d'eau has been transformed from a utilitarian structure into a vibrant cultural venue. Since 1999, it has been repurposed as a municipal exhibition space known as Château d'eau - Château d'art. This transformation has breathed new life into the historic building, allowing it to host a variety of cultural events and exhibitions.

Visitors to the Château d'eau can explore its interior, which now serves as a hub for contemporary art. The space regularly features exhibitions from local and international artists, offering a platform for creative expression and cultural exchange. The building's unique architecture provides an inspiring backdrop for the diverse range of artworks on display.

A Hub for Art and Culture

The Château d'eau is more than just an exhibition space; it is a dynamic center for the arts in Bourges. Collaborating with cultural associations such as Bandits-Mages and Emmetrop, as well as the École nationale supérieure d'art de Bourges, the venue hosts numerous events that engage the community and foster a love for the arts.

From contemporary art exhibitions to performances and visual arts events, the Château d'eau offers a rich tapestry of cultural experiences. It plays a pivotal role in the city's cultural landscape, attracting art enthusiasts and curious visitors alike. Architectural Marvels and Artistic Heritage

The Château d'eau's architectural beauty is complemented by its rich artistic heritage. The sculptures by Jules Dumoutet, a renowned artist and archaeologist from the Berry region, add a layer of historical depth to the structure. These intricate carvings, depicting various motifs, reflect the artistic sensibilities of the 19th century and contribute to the tower's allure.
